Intel Core i7-7800X

Cores: 6, Threads: 12, Base Frequency: 3.5GHz, Boost Frequency: 4GHz, Cache: 8.25MB, TDP: 140W, Memory Channel: Quad, PCIe Lanes: 28

Intel® Hyper Threading Technology (Intel® HT Technology) <b>Improved Performance for Threaded Software</b> Intel® Hyper-Threading Technology (Intel® HT Technology) makes efficient use of processor resources, enabling multiple threads to run on each core and increasing processor throughput. Available on Intel® Core™ and Intel® Xeon® processors, Intel HT Technology helps run demanding applications simultaneously, protect and manage systems, and provide headroom for business growth.
Intel® Turbo Boost Technology <b>Higher Performance When You Need It Most</b> Intel® Turbo Boost Technology 2.0 accelerates processor and graphics performance by increasing the operating frequency when operating below specification limits. The maximum frequency varies depending on workload, hardware, software, and overall system configuration. 2.0
Intel® AES New Instructions (Intel® AES-NI) <b>Added Security with Faster Data Encryption</b> The Intel® Advanced Encryption Standard New Instructions (Intel® AES-NI) enable fast and secure data encryption and decryption for better performance and less risk from timing and cache-based attacks than table-based software implementations. Intel AES-NI supports usages such as standard key lengths, standard modes of operation, and even some nonstandard or future variants.
